Who We Are

Alpine Accelerate is a student-led nonprofit organization dedicated to making high-quality math, English, and reading support accessible to elementary school students. Through structured group sessions, we help students strengthen core skills, improve problem-solving abilities, and gain confidence in a supportive and engaging environment.
